Перейти к основному содержанию

Zabbix server: remaining connection slots are reserved for roles with the SUPERUSER attribute

Zabbix

На свежеустановленном сервере Zabbix 7.4 с БД PostgreSQL практически сразу поймал ошибку вида:

database is down: reconnecting in 10 seconds
[Z3001] connection to database 'zabbix' failed: [0] connection to server at "localhost" (::1), port 5432 failed: FATAL:  remaining connection slots are reserved for roles with the SUPERUSER attribute

zabbix

Из описания уже становится понятно, что Zabbix Server упёрся в лимит соединения с базой данных. Если заглянуть в логи postgresql, то можно увидеть:

FATAL:  remaining connection slots are reserved for roles with the SUPERUSER attribute

zabbix

Проблему можно решить конфигурацией PostgreSQL. В postgresql.conf увеличиваем максимальное количество соединений с БД.

zabbix

По умолчанию установлено значение 25, очень странно, раньше по умолчанию стояло 100.

max_connections = 25  # (change requires restart)

Добавим.

zabbix

Пусть пока будет 100, посмотрим как поведёт себя сервер Zabbix.

max_connections = 100  # (change requires restart)

Перезагружаем postgresql сервер. Готово.

Теги

 

Похожие материалы

Zabbix шаблон для мониторинга сервера Supermicro X10DRi

Делюсь полезным шаблоном для мониторинга сервера Supermicro X10DRi.  Если быть более точным, то у сервера нет имени, у него материнка X10DRi-T и корпус 4 юнита. Только что собрал. В шаблоне 5 приложений, 53 элемента данных, 39 триггеров и 5 графиков. Мониторим по IPMI. 

Zabbix шаблон для мониторинга RAID контроллеров Intel RSTe и VROC в Windows

Делюсь полезным шаблоном для мониторинга программных RAID контроллеров Intel RST (Rapid Storage Technology), Intel RSTe (Intel Rapid Enterprise), Intel VROC (Virtual RAID on CPU).